Jordin Sparks Remembers Hanging with Whitney Houston on Set of 'Sparkle'

Credit: Alicia Gbur/Sony Pictures/AP Photo.

"Sparkle," the movie in which Jordin Sparks makes her film debut, hits theaters August 17, and of course, it also features the late Whitney Houston in the role of Sparks' character's mom.  In the new issue of V magazine, Sparks recalled what it was like hanging out on set with the superstar, who had always been an idol of hers.

"She walked in and I was like 'This.Is.Awesome,' Sparks said.  "She was always so full of light.  Every day, she would open the door and say, 'How are my babies this morning?  Are my babies good? God is good. Praise the Lord.'"

Sparks also remembered a moment on set where she got some insight into one of Houston's biggest hits.  "One day, actually, she was walking behind me and singing, 'I Have Nothing,'" she told V.  "And then she reached out and said, 'I forgot I sang that.  I was annoyed that day and just didn't want to do it.  We ended up doing it in three takes!'"

"Sparkle" is the latest entry in Jordin's resume, which includes successful albums, a fragrance, a starring role on Broadway and charity work.  "I definitely want to build an empire," she told V.
